The rear seats with the headrest option is...

"Massage Seat Function (Front and Rear) incl. Seat Ventilation (Front and Rear) $4,060"

"Massage function for driver and all passenger seats, each with 10 air cushions in the backrests. Five massage programs with varying degrees of intensity are available for selection. Includes Seat Ventilation (Front and Rear).

Note: Only in conjunction with 14-way power seats (front)."

Originally Posted by ljcool_17
I'd like to ask your choice of seat for the new Panamera
I think that would be personal preference and body type. You should try sitting in the various seats. 18-way adds adjustment for side bolsters at the seat and torso versus 14-way. I have 18-way seats, but I am slender and bolster adjustments help to make for a snug fit. The seats are firm, but I can drive for several hours before needing to stop for a stretch.
